FAQ
- What is N-able's total cost of revenue?
- N-able (NABL) reported total cost of revenue of $32.02M in Q2 2026.
- How has N-able's total cost of revenue changed year-over-year?
- N-able's total cost of revenue increased by 11.3% year-over-year, from $28.77M to $32.02M.
- What is the long-term trend for N-able's total cost of revenue?
-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), N-able's total cost of revenue has grown at a 22.3%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$52.43M to $117.36M.
- What does total cost of revenue mean?
- The aggregate of all direct costs attributable to producing goods and delivering services that generated the company's revenue, including materials, labor, and overhead.
